What are the advantages of using optical fiber instead of radio waves to carry signals?

see www.soe.ucsc.edu/classes/cmpe150/Fall05/lecture6.ppt for the answerAnswerThe biggest is less attenuation (degradation) of signal, so that a message can travel significantly further over an optical fibre than over a copper (twisted pair of coax) cable before it becomes too garbled to understand. In addition, fibre optic cables are generally immune to electromagnetic interference (such as strong electrical or magnetic fields) nearby, while copper cables can have such interference reduce or completely destroy their ability to carry signals. Finally, it is much easier to transmit on multiple channels (frequencies) over fibre than over copper, so a fibre optic cable can handle many more simultaneous message streams than twisted pair or coax. In short: fibre allows hugely greater distances between endpoints, is practically immune to outside interference, and can handle hundreds or thousands of times more signal channels than twisted pair or coaxial cable.


Can STM-1 SDH Radio system be used in ring?

SDH Radio can be use in ring configuration, point to point, add drop and can complement fiber optic ring. For add drop configuration, ADM need to be installed. Just imagine SDH radio a wireless fiber with STM-1 x n capacity.

What is cladding in an optical cable?

A layer of a glass surrounding the center fiber of a glass inside a fiber-optic cable is called cladding.

What layers of the standard fiber optic cable are necessary for each individual glass filament in order for them to be bundled together with other fibers?

There are 4 layers in a standard fiber optic cable necessary for bundling: 1. Cladding 2. The Buffer 3. The Strenghener 4. The Outer Jacket. They surround the fiber in this order.
